Lifesaving well being initiatives and medical analysis initiatives have shut down all over the world in response to the Trump administration’s 90-day pause on overseas help and stop-work orders.

In Uganda, the Nationwide Malaria Management Program has suspended spraying insecticide into village houses and ceased shipments of mattress nets for distribution to pregnant girls and younger kids, stated Dr. Jimmy Opigo, this system’s director.

Medical provides, together with medication to cease hemorrhages in pregnant girls and rehydration salts that deal with life-threatening diarrhea in toddlers, can’t attain villages in Zambia as a result of the trucking firms transporting them had been paid by a suspended provide undertaking of the USA Company for Worldwide Improvement, U.S.A.I.D.

Dozens of medical trials in South Asia, Africa and Latin America have been suspended. Hundreds of individuals enrolled within the research have medication, vaccines and medical gadgets of their our bodies however now not have entry to persevering with remedy or to the researchers who had been supervising their care.

In interviews, greater than 20 researchers and program managers described the upheaval in well being methods in international locations throughout the creating world. Most agreed to be interviewed on the situation that their names not be revealed, fearing that talking to a reporter would jeopardize any risk that their initiatives would possibly be capable of reopen.

Lots of these interviewed broke down in tears as they described the speedy destruction of many years of labor.

The packages which have frozen or folded over the previous six days supported frontline take care of infectious illness, offering remedies and preventive measures that assist avert thousands and thousands of deaths from AIDS, tuberculosis, malaria and different ailments. In addition they offered a compassionate, beneficiant picture of the USA in international locations the place China has more and more competed for affect.

The State Division and U.S.A.I.D. didn’t reply to requests for remark.

There’ll now be nobody to take custody of thousands and thousands of {dollars}’ price of provides for very important oxygen methods, bought for packages funded by U.S.A.I.D. that help well being clinics in a few of the world’s poorest international locations. The shipments, now in transit, are scheduled to achieve ports within the coming days, however workers of these packages have been ordered to cease work.

On Tuesday night time, Secretary of State Marco Rubio issued an exemption to the funding freeze for “lifesaving humanitarian help,” together with what a State Division memo known as “core lifesaving drugs.” Nevertheless, shuttered H.I.V. and tuberculosis remedy packages have been instructed by their contacts at U.S.A.I.D. that they can not resume work till they obtain written instruction that the waiver applies particularly to them.

Few have been in a position to acquire clarification on whether or not and when their work can proceed as a result of their assigned contacts at U.S.A.I.D. have both been fired or furloughed, or are beneath strict directions to not speak to anybody.

Hundreds of individuals have already misplaced their jobs on account of the freeze. About 500 U.S.-based workers of U.S.A.I.D. had been fired. In international locations from India to Zimbabwe, employees members for well being initiatives had been instantly fired. A company known as the Worldwide Centre for Diarrhoeal Illness Analysis, Bangladesh, which does analysis on a prime killer of youngsters, laid off greater than 1,000 workers this week.

If the waiver introduced by Mr. Rubio doesn’t apply to their work — as is probably going as a result of it’s anticipated to exempt solely a slim scope of actions — many nonprofit teams won’t have sufficient funds to pay their workers or preserve provides. Already, organizations that depend on U.S.A.I.D. funds haven’t been ready entry any cash, even for reimbursement of bills already incurred.

Two-thirds of the employees of the President’s Malaria Initiative, a corporation based by former President George W. Bush that’s the largest donor to anti-malaria packages and analysis worldwide, have been fired. These workers had been contract employees members, as a result of the company had longtime hiring freezes for everlasting positions, and included a few of the most senior and revered scientists engaged on malaria management on the earth.

Whereas the interruption of H.I.V. remedy has prompted an outcry, the suspension of malaria work additionally instantly jeopardizes lives, stated a scientist who was a senior employees member on the President’s Malaria Initiative for a decade and was fired on Tuesday.

Malaria interventions in Africa are rigorously deliberate round wet seasons, the time of which varies by area. Homes are sprayed with insecticide, and kids are handled with an antimalarial medicine throughout peak malaria transmission instances.

“You could possibly open the funding floodgates once more tomorrow and you’ll nonetheless have kids dying months from now due to this pause,” the scientist stated.

Greater than 50 million kids obtained preventative medication earlier than the wet season final yr.

The supply of speedy assessments and malaria medication into Myanmar, the place instances of malaria elevated almost tenfold to 850,000 in 2023 (the latest figures obtainable) from 78,000 in 2019, has been frozen. Some organizations now don’t have any staff left to distribute the provides even when they had been to reach.

In some components of the nation, greater than 40 p.c of instances are of a kind of malaria that’s typically lethal in kids beneath the age of 5. Malaria medication would appear to qualify beneath the stipulation of “lifesaving humanitarian help, together with important medicines” included within the waiver, however within the absence of certainty, nobody has been daring sufficient to attempt to free the medication now caught on the Thai border.

Some 2.4 million anti-malaria mattress nets are sitting in manufacturing amenities in Asia, manufactured to satisfy U.S.-funded orders and certain for international locations throughout sub-Saharan Africa. These contracts are actually frozen, as a result of the usA.I.D. subcontractor that purchased them just isn’t allowed to speak to the producer beneath the phrases of the freeze. Contracts for eight million extra nets are actually in limbo, an govt with the producer stated.

U.S.A.I.D.’s largest undertaking is named the worldwide well being provide chain, an effort to streamline procurement of provides for H.I.V., malaria, maternal well being and different key areas, to make the system extra environment friendly and lower your expenses. It operates in additional than 55 international locations the place, in lots of instances, it provides the majority of key medicines. Now its international net of employees has been ordered to cease work apart from important duties, like guarding commodities in warehouses.

In Zambia, U.S.A.I.D. helps the majority distribution of public well being merchandise, utilizing the personal trucking business to maneuver medicines from a central provide depot to seven regional hubs, from which they’re taken by truck, bike and boat to rural well being facilities. It’s a part of the in depth U.S. help of the well being system in Zambia, one of many world’s poorest international locations, and over time it has been working to construct up the availability chain capability of the federal government.

For the reason that stop-work order was issued final Saturday, all the autos transporting well being merchandise have been stopped. “They’ve successfully paralyzed the Zambian public well being sector by pulling out so abruptly,” stated one advisor who labored with this system. Related U.S.-funded methods, now frozen, additionally moved a serious share of fundamental medical provides in Mozambique, Nigeria, Malawi and Haiti.

In East Africa, medical researchers engaged on initiatives to seek out methods to cease transmission of H.I.V. and develop more practical contraception have discovered themselves floundering for explanations to provide to contributors of their medical trials.

“We’ve girls testing vaginal rings, they have already got the rings in them, individuals who obtained an injectable for H.I.V. prevention — while you say ‘cease,’ what occurs to them?” stated an H.I.V. researcher who’s an investigator on quite a lot of medical trials. “We’ve an moral obligation to individuals who volunteer for trials.”
